Corn Patties with Salsa

Prep: 15min
| Servings: 4 | Cook: 10min

Ingredients

  • 2 Avocados
  • 1 Lime (juice)
  • 150 g cherry tomatoes
  • 1 handful parsley
  • Salt
  • pepper (from grinder)
  • 1 tsp sweet paprika
  • Tabasco
  • 180 g Corn kernels (canned)
  • 1 Spring onion
  • 1 stalk sage
  • Salt
  • 180 g Corn flour
  • 280 ml milk
  • 2 Eggs
  • 6 tbsp vegetable oil

Instructions

  1. 1.

    For the salsa, halve the avocados, remove the pit, peel off the skin and dice the flesh. Drizzle with lime juice. Wash and quarter the tomatoes. Rinse and chop the parsley. Mix everything together and season with salt, pepper, paprika and Tabasco.

  2. 2.

    To make the patties, drain the corn well. Wash, trim and slice the spring onion into fine rings. Rinse and finely chop the sage. Whisk the corn flour with milk and a pinch of salt until smooth. Fold in the eggs and then stir in the corn, spring onion and sage.

  3. 3.

    Heat some oil in a hot pan. Drop spoonfuls of the batter into the hot fat and fry each side for 2–3 minutes until golden‑brown. Drain on kitchen paper and keep warm in an oven at 80 °C if desired.

  4. 4.

    Serve the corn patties with the salsa on top.
